Let your radiators cool down. Turn off your central heating and let the radiator cool down. When you bleed a radiator, you run the risk of water escaping. So, to prevent injury, cooling your radiators makes any escaping water run cold rather than scorching hot. Step 3. Protect the area.

So, to prevent … dixper botWebBleeding your radiators regularly helps to remove air which is trapped in the central heating system. If air is present, there is less space for the hot water and this will prevent the radiator from heating up correctly.
